Crushed Ice Cake (Stained Glass Cake)
- 2 14 cups crushed graham crackers
- 3 (85 g) packages Jello gelatin (orange, strawberry and lime)
- 1 12 cups boiling water, per package
- 1 cup crushed pineapple in juice or 1 cup unsweetened pineapple juice
- 1 (7 g) package unflavored gelatin (Knox)
- 14 cup cold water
- 12 cup butter
- 12 cup brown sugar
- 12 pint whipping cream (1 cup)
- 12 cup white s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la
- Make jello; set in pie plates.
- Heat pineapple/juice.
- Mix unflavoured gelatin with cold water; add to juice.
- Set aside to cool, stirring occasionally, until the mixture has the consistency of egg whites.
- Melt butter; add to graham crumbs and brown sugar.
- Press into 9x13 pan, reserving 1/4 cup crumb mixture for the top.
- Cut jello into cubes in the pan and place pans in fridge.
- Beat cream until thick; beat in 1/2 cup white sugar and 1 tsp vanilla.
- Carefully combine jello with juice mixture (a spatula usually scoops the jello out well.
- ).
- Fold in whipped cream.
- Spread mixture over crust and sprinkle reserved graham crumbs on top.
- Let set in fridge.
